ROFL, sorry Dutk....but you'd have trouble downloading a video card! The video card is the actual PCB (printed circuit board) that you plug into the slot on your motherboard. A driver is the piece of software that tells windows and games how to communicate with your card. You can find out which card you have by going into control panel -> system -> display adapters/video cards....I forget the exact categorisation in windows....but you get the idea. Then you should go online to the site of your card's manufacturer and search for the latest drivers....which of course you might already have...but having the latest drivers almost always inproves performance.
